Premier League: West Brom vs Stoke City match preview
A look at Tony Pulis's meeting with his former employers at The Hawthorns
Tony Pulis will be looking to get one over on the club who sacked him twice during his seven-year stint at the Britannia Stadium. The Welshman had led The Potters to Premier League promotion, five consecutive finishes in the top-flight, an FA Cup final and a Europa League campaign before his second dismissal in May 2012.
Compatriot Mark Hughes is excelling in charge of The Potters, with Stoke on course for another top-half finish under his stewardship. Pulis has steered the Baggies clear of danger and a win on Saturday would all but eliminate relegation fears for another season.

Past Three Meetings:
Stoke City (Diouf 2) 2-0 West Brom, Premier League, December 2014
West Brom (Sessegnon) 1-2 Stoke City (McAuley og, Adam) Premier League, May 2014
Stoke City 0-0 West Brom, Premier League, October 2013

STATS:
Saido Berahino has scored 18 goals this season - already double last year’s goal tally.
Before their league defeat at Villa Park on March 3, West Brom hadn’t lost an away game since a 2-0 loss at Stoke in December.
If Stoke win today, it will be the first time that they have won four Premier League games on the bounce.
Classic Moment:
West Brom 0-3 Stoke - 2010
Goals from Matthew Etherington and Jonathan Walters (2) recorded Stoke’s third successive Premier League victory during their third season in the top-flight.
